This lot features a Tie-Tack, which boasts an elegant cultured pearl at the forefront of the piece, and framed by 18 karat gold cross pieces. The fine pearl that stands so prominently was harvested by living oysters in Japan by Caribe Pearls. All-in-all, the tie-tack is in good shape, doesn't display any patina, and comes in its original box. The box the tie-tack comes in measures approximately 2 1/4" wide, 2 5/8" deep, and 1 3/4" tall.
